What Does a Taxi to Luton Airport Cost?
Luton Airport sits 32 miles north of Central London in Bedfordshire, connected primarily via the M1 motorway. As one of the UK's fastest-growing airports — particularly popular with budget carriers like Wizz Air, easyJet, and Ryanair — understanding Luton taxi prices is essential for the millions of passengers who pass through each year.
A pre-booked private transfer from Central London costs between £70 and £90, which is significantly cheaper than a metered black cab at £95 to £150. Luton Taxi Fares by London Area
| Pickup Area | Distance | Private Transfer | Black Cab (est.) | Journey Time |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Central London (W1/WC1) | 32 miles | £70 – £90 | £95 – £150 | 50–80 min |
| North London (N1–N20) | 25 miles | £55 – £70 | £70 – £110 | 40–60 min |
| West London (W3/W5) | 30 miles | £65 – £85 | £85 – £135 | 50–75 min |
| City / Canary Wharf | 35 miles | £80 – £100 | £105 – £165 | 60–90 min |
| South London (SE/SW) | 38 miles | £85 – £105 | £115 – £175 | 65–95 min |
| St Albans / Watford | 12 miles | £30 – £45 | £35 – £55 | 20–30 min |

Luton Taxi vs. Train — Which Is Cheaper?
| Option | Cost | Time |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| Thameslink Train + DART | £15–22 + DART shuttle | 25–45 min + 5 min shuttle | DART connects Luton Parkway to terminal |
| East Midlands Railway | £13–30 | 22–35 min from St Pancras | Faster but less frequent |
| National Express Coach | £8–15 | 60–90 min from Victoria | Budget option, can be slow |
| Private Transfer | £70–90 (up to 3 pax) | 50–80 min door-to-door | All-inclusive, no shuttle needed |

M1 Motorway — What to Expect
The M1 is the primary route from London to Luton. Traffic patterns that affect metered fares (but not fixed-price transfers) include:
- Junction 6A (M25): Heavy congestion during rush hours, can add 20+ minutes
- Junction 10 (Luton exit): Weekend mornings can be busy during holiday season
- Roadworks: The M1 smart motorway upgrades occasionally cause delays
